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.06.26;
Скачать: CL | DM;

Вниз

сортировка по клику на колонке   Найти похожие ветки 

 
rosl   (2003-06-04 03:44) [0]

Народ подскажите пожалуйста!!!
Делаю запрос sql, вывожу его в dbgrid, но хочу чтоб работала сортировка по клику на колонке.
В dbgrid в событии ONTitleClick пишу:
Query1.SQL.Add("ORDER BY "+""DBGrid1.column.FieldName"");
не получается, может кто подскажет.


 
first_aid ©   (2003-06-04 05:06) [1]

Сделай:

Query1.Close;
Query1.SQL.Clear;
Query1.SQL.Add("Текст запроса " + "ORDER BY "+ "DBGrid1.column.FieldName");
Query1.Open;


 
passm ©   (2003-06-04 09:20) [2]

Или воспользоваться RxQuery и макросом.
Тогда текст запроса:
SELECT T1.FIELD1, T1.FIELD2
FROM TABLE1 T1
ORDER BY %ORD_COL

И при клике на Title
RxQuery1.MacroByName("ORD_COL").AsString:= Column.FieldName



Страницы: 1 вся ветка

Текущий архив: 2003.06.26;
Скачать: CL | DM;

Наверх




Память: 0.46 MB
Время: 0.017 c
3-83874
Ann
2003-06-02 14:18
2003.06.26
Grid


3-83998
off
2003-05-27 06:43
2003.06.26
Считаем баланс?


1-84097
Chlavik
2003-06-10 15:01
2003.06.26
ПРодолжение...


1-84289
Александр из Минска
2003-06-07 21:34
2003.06.26
I/O error 32


3-83983
sergei12r
2003-05-30 06:51
2003.06.26
нужно перекинуть dbaseские даные на parabox програмно